Fig. 3.

MAP-mapping of pERK shows that Cxcr4 inhibition has limited effect on canonical Ras signaling in the brain. (A,B) MAP-maps showing statistically significant median z-score differences in non-treated (A) nf1a+/−;nf1b+/− versus wild-type larvae and (B) nf1a−/−;nf1b−/− versus wild-type larvae. Green signals represent increased pERK levels in nf1 mutant larvae compared to wild type. Magenta signals denote decreased levels of phosphorylated ERK1/2 (pERK) in nf1 mutant larvae compared to those in wild type. (C,E) Genotype-matched plerixafor treatment. MAP-maps showing statistically significant median z-score differences in non-treated versus 3 µM plerixafor-treated wild-type (C), nf1a+/−;nf1b+/− (D) and nf1a−/−;nf1b−/− (E) larvae. Green signals represent increased pERK levels in plerixafor-treated compared to non-treated larvae within each genotype. Magenta signals represent decreased pERK levels in plerixafor-treated compared to non-treated larvae within each genotype. Arrowheads indicate the torus semicircularis region of interest (ROI) within the midbrain. Arrows indicate the olfactory bulb ROI. All larvae were fixed and stained at 6 dpf. The z-scores were calculated using Mann–Whitney U statistics with the significance threshold set by using a false discovery rate (FDR) of 0.00005. n=18-20 larvae per treatment group. A, anterior; D, dorsal; P, posterior; V, ventral. Scale bars: 200 µM.
